Bedienungsanleitung
- Fügen Sie JSON in den Editor ein oder ziehen Sie eine JSON-/JSONC-/NDJSON-Datei hinein.
- Wählen Sie eine Aktion: Format / Minify / Validate / TS / Zod / XML.
- Kopieren oder laden Sie das Ergebnis herunter, oder öffnen Sie die Diff-Ansicht zur Änderungskontrolle.
- Sollte die Validierung fehlschlagen, beheben Sie den Fehler anhand der Zeilen-/Spaltenangabe und starten Sie die Generierung erneut.
Kernfunktionen
- JSON formatieren: Nutzen Sie Pretty-Print für verbesserte Lesbarkeit und Review.
- JSON komprimieren: Minimieren Sie JSON-Objekte zur Optimierung von Datenübertragung und Speicherung.
- Syntax validieren: Genaue Fehlerhervorhebung mit Angabe von Zeile und Spalte.
- Typen generieren: Erstellen Sie TypeScript-Interfaces und Zod-Schemas direkt aus echten JSON-Daten.
- JSON in XML konvertieren: Einfache Konvertierung für Legacy-Systeme und Integrationen.
- Änderungen vergleichen: Integrierte Diff-Ansicht – alles läuft lokal und sicher auf Ihrem Gerät.
Verwandte Tools
Der FIRE-Rechner 2026 mit Inflationsbereinigung. Simulieren Sie die reale Kaufkraft, analysieren Sie Vorsorgelücken und erstellen Sie Ihren finanziellen Fahrplan. Exportieren Sie Daten per Klick als CSV für Excel oder Notion. 100 % privat, lokale Berechnung im Browser.
Berechnen Sie die Trading-Positionsgröße aus Kontostand, Risiko %, Einstiegspreis und Stop-Loss. Läuft lokal in Ihrem Browser und ermöglicht den Vergleich verschiedener Risikoszenarien vor dem Trade.
Berechnen Sie den Zinseszins aus Anfangskapital, regelmäßigen Beiträgen, jährlicher Rendite (APY) und Laufzeit. Visualisieren Sie Kapital, Zinsen und Endguthaben mit einem lokalen interaktiven Diagramm.
Nutzen Sie diesen Kreditrechner / Tilgungsrechner, um die monatliche Rate, die Zinsen und den Tilgungsplan lokal zu berechnen. Geben Sie Kreditsumme, Zinssatz und Laufzeit ein, um sofort Ergebnisse und Diagramme zu sehen.
Nutzen Sie diesen Investment-Rechner / ROI-Rechner, um Anfangskapital, monatliche Sparraten, jährliche Rendite und inflationsbereinigte Ergebnisse lokal zu schätzen. Visualisieren Sie prognostizierte Renditen mit einem Zinseszins-Diagramm, ROI und einem Jahresplan.
Nutzen Sie diesen APR-zu-APY-Rechner, um APR und APY lokal umzurechnen. Geben Sie einen Zinssatz ein, wählen Sie die Zinsperioden und sehen Sie sofort den effektiven Jahreszins, die Differenz und den Häufigkeitsvergleich.
Nutzen Sie diesen Gewinnspannen-Rechner, um Bruttogewinn, Aufschlag (Markup), Marge (Margin) und Verkaufspreis lokal zu berechnen. Geben Sie Kosten und Preis oder Kosten und Zielmarge ein, um Ihre Margen sofort zu berechnen.
Nutzen Sie diesen CPM- und CPC-Rechner, um Werbeausgaben, Impressionen, Klicks, CPM, CPC und CTR lokal zu berechnen. Geben Sie Budget und Zielkosten ein, um Kampagnenszenarien sofort zu planen.
Berechnungslogik
- Das Parsen erfolgt über
JSON.parse, die Formatierung überJSON.stringify. - Die Typgenerierung durchläuft Objekte und Arrays rekursiv und übersetzt Felder in TS- oder Zod-Syntax.
- Die Diff-Darstellung nutzt einen auf LCS (Longest Common Subsequence) basierenden Text-Diff-Algorithmus.
- Rechenintensive Aufgaben können im Web Worker ausgeführt werden, um die Benutzeroberfläche reaktionsschnell zu halten.
Häufig gestellte Fragen
- Ist das Tool kostenlos und gibt es Limits?
- Ja – Formatierung, Validierung, TS-/Zod-Generierung, XML-Konvertierung und der Diff-Vergleich sind völlig kostenlos nutzbar.
- Sind meine Daten privat? Wird mein JSON hochgeladen?
- Nein, es gibt keine Uploads. Alle Operationen laufen lokal in Ihrem Browser, auch bei vertraulichen Keys.
- Wie konvertiere ich JSON automatisch in TypeScript-Interfaces?
- Fügen Sie Ihr JSON ein und klicken Sie auf TS, um sofort standardisierte TypeScript-Interfaces zu generieren.
- Warum schlägt JSON.parse bei scheinbar korrektem JSON fehl? (Technische Details)
- Häufige Ursachen sind überflüssige Kommas (Trailing Commas), fehlende Anführungszeichen bei Schlüsseln, einfache Anführungszeichen, Kommentare (JSONC) oder nicht geschlossene Klammern.
- Wozu dient die Zod-Schema-Generierung aus JSON?
- Zod ermöglicht die Validierung zur Laufzeit, sodass Ihre Anwendung Abweichungen in API-Strukturen sofort sicher abfangen kann.